Type
ORACLE
Validation date
2023-09-18 11:32: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02954,
    "usd": 0.03171
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001270544DF14EC4B21444065C49CF4343F05669F95EA809BC5B3C14C76747771FA

Previous signature

CEE3E45EF2E2505D0C4E261AF73F49C18693148D2B0C5A776AD4C3BFBCF09C21CA5D09BE656C20E3287140631EDF023590DFC5BF9796A56225BC04D37BABDF04

Origin signature

3044022007FF1C901AF7BA8128DD9C34C0DD72D7953A11543F5665A6FE67BDE8003C9EDC02207713CD3BA416F4DF6810654841D68E952BC0162B8CE3475F91C1485DD17EF395

Proof of work

010204AF51D99C93DE579ACCC586B132BC6BBD609D68A5101B9650E0344285202981B7C3088D84465D5012EB598E3BCDC7D3540BEC6F2E7AB666485D354687D41AAE40

Proof of integrity

00566C1B5BE6F463187F0C029C4952CAC7C09A0093122F6976FE85D76C9C560EC7

Coordinator signature

493F20BDCD6D6956A867270EF2F470AA1909D45EDEF2BEF8F72D5E3BABF88D400FF557F3020D40DC0E0664FC59DE2AC8EF364F34A131D8623F5FC4B852451F08

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

B776CD0C0A1D056068778F60DC23A87D18EBBDEDF796E465C869D1E2AAB8E3D5061FBBECA37757C7A696117408A90D20F4935D576DC19376189F428F2BF09A06

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

3BD3419745DA45773A676048D0762C8E4AF030FA01C43129B02418D9F1D35F365424788416B9893FB3D7AE5B1E69527B9CB64C7BAF03CEDF49C08B6A2E5E8D0E